Output ec5e33b4b0c69b57a5dddc3d89dfb76a2e61a4a9a7f3f98a2dfbd03e25c238ca:1

value
14999498
script pubkey
OP_0 OP_PUSHBYTES_20 fabca25ccb129eea4b5174d3dfe22f211e9acccb
address
bc1ql272yhxtz20w5j63wnfalc30yy0f4nxtcy6gam
transaction
ec5e33b4b0c69b57a5dddc3d89dfb76a2e61a4a9a7f3f98a2dfbd03e25c238ca
confirmations
25645
spent
true